ItemMetadata, élément (MSBuild)ItemMetadata element (MSBuild)

Contient une clé de métadonnées d’élément définie par l’utilisateur, qui contient la valeur des métadonnées de l’élément.Contains a user-defined item metadata key, which contains the item metadata value. Un élément peut comporter un nombre quelconque de paires clé-valeur de métadonnées.An item may have any number of metadata key-value pairs.

<Project><Project>
<ItemGroup><ItemGroup>
<Item><Item>

SyntaxeSyntax

<ItemMetadataName> Item Metadata value</ItemMetadataName>  

Attributs et élémentsAttributes and elements

Les sections suivantes décrivent des attributs, des éléments enfants et des éléments parents.The following sections describe attributes, child elements, and parent elements.

AttributsAttributes

AttributAttribute DescriptionDescription
Condition Attribut facultatif.Optional attribute.

Condition à évaluer.Condition to be evaluated. Pour plus d’informations, consultez l’article Conditions (Conditions MSBuild).For more information, see Conditions.

Éléments enfantsChild elements

Aucun.None.

Éléments parentsParent elements

ÉlémentElement DescriptionDescription
ItemItem Élément défini par l’utilisateur qui définit les entrées pour le processus de génération.A user-defined element that defines the inputs for the build process.

Valeur texteText value

Une valeur texte est facultative.A text value is optional.

Ce texte spécifie la valeur des métadonnées de l’élément (texte ou XML).This text specifies the item metadata value, which can be either text or XML.

ExempleExample

L’exemple de code ci-après indique comment ajouter des métadonnées Culture avec la valeur fr à l’élément CSFile.The following code example shows how to add Culture metadata with the value fr to the item CSFile.

<ItemGroup>  
    <CSFile Include="main.cs" >  
        <Culture>fr</Culture>  
    </CSFile>  
</ItemGroup>  

Voir aussiSee also

Informations de référence sur le schéma de fichier projet Project file schema reference
ÉlémentsItems